The sandstone formed from sand and other sediment deposited along the …Mushroom Rocks of Jordan. The layering of different mineral content and hardness creates uneven weathering along horizontal plains. This can result in the aggressive erosion of the softer layers undercutting the harder layers above. Jan 1, 2014 · Mushroom-shaped rocks are formed by a variety of processes involving differential weathering and erosion/abrasion. They illustrate the concept of equifinality in geomorphology: similar forms produced by different processes. Mushroom Rock.
